#16A722 Color
#16A722 is rgb(22, 167, 34) in RGB, hsl(125, 77%, 37%) in HSL, and about cmyk(87%, 0%, 80%, 35%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Vine Green (#38A32A),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 7.44.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#16A722 Channel Values
How #16A722 bre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 22 · G 167 · B 34 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 125° · S 77% · L 37%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 125° · S 87% · V 65%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 87% · M 0% · Y 80% · K 35%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 3.19:1 vs white · 6.58: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|

#16A722 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#16A722?
#16A722 is a dark green — rgb(22, 167, 34) in RGB and hsl(125, 77%, 37%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Vine Green (#38A32A),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 7.44.
What is the RGB value of #16A722?
#16A722 is rgb(22, 167, 34) — red 22, green 167, and blue 34 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#16A722?
#16A722 converts to approximately cmyk(87%, 0%, 80%, 35%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#16A722 be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#16A722 scores 3.19:1 against white and 6.58: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#16A722 as a CSS color keyword?
No. #16A722 is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is forestgreen (#228B22) at a CIE76 distance of 15.96, which is visibly different.
